Another new bird for my life list! This male northern harrier just sat in the grass clumps for a long time, looking this way and that, searching for prey I assume. It may have been guarding a nest nearby, as they nest on the ground.
We parked alongside the road and watched for maybe ten minutes. Finally it took off after something in the grass. It flew a zig-zag pattern close to the ground, obviously chasing something, occasionally pouncing but never coming up with anything. Eventually it just flew away over the hills.
